TERMS AND CONDITIONS OF COMMISSIONING AND REPRODUCTION OF PICTURES FROM V1IMAGES AVIATION MEDIA

1. Terms and Definitions:

(a) picture includes a photograph, images, transparency, negative, digital scan, design, artwork, painting, montage drawing, engraving or any other item which may be offered for the purposes of reproduction;
(b) reproduction includes any form of publication or copying of the whole or part of any picture and whether or not altered by printing, photography, slide projection (whether or not to an audience) xerography, artist’s reference, artist’s illustration, layout or presentation, electronic or mechanical reproduction or storage by any other means;
(c) the Photographer (otherwise known as Group Photographers listed here) are the Author of the photographs.
(d) the Client is the person or organisation to whom the invoice is addressed (whether or not the Client is acting for a third party);
(e) v1images Aviation Media administers the licensing of the works of the Group Photographers listed here. v1images Aviation Media is a company registered in England;
(f) These terms and conditions represent the entirety of the agreement between v1images Aviation Media and the Client. Any variation is only applicable when agreed in advance and in writing;

2. Copyright and Ownership of Materials:

(a) The entire copyright in the pictures is retained by the Photographer at all times throughout the world and is administered by v1images Aviation Media;
(b) Title to all photographs remains the property of the Photographer;
(c) Images will be licensed for use for a specified period. When the License to Use has expired, the images should be returned to the Photographer and a written undertaking given that all digital files have been destroyed. The Client is expected to comply with this requirement within 30 days of expiration of the License to Use. The v1images Aviation Media reserves the right to make an additional charge for continued use after this period;
(d) The Photographer, as administered by v1images Aviation Media, supplies the technical and artistic ability to illustrate an idea photographically, and sells the right to reproduce those pictures in a given context. No property or copyright in any pictures shall pass to the Client whether on its submission or on v1images Aviation Media’s grant of reproduction rights in respect thereof;
(e) v1images Aviation Media Group Photographers asserts both their moral right to be identified as the author of their work and the right to a credit is asserted in accordance with sections 77 and 78 of Copyright, Designs and Patents Act 1988;
(f) Unless otherwise agreed in writing if any picture reproduced by the Client omits the copyright notice or credit line specified by v1images Aviation Media any fee payable by the Client shall be subject to an increase specified by v1images Aviation Media, and in any event an increase of not less than 25%.

3. Use and Reproduction:

(a) The License to Use only comes into effect once full payment of the invoice has been made. No use may be made of the images until full and final payment – including any late payment charges that may have been levied – has been received by v1images Aviation Media;
(b) Permission in writing may be granted for image use before payment, however this permission will be immediately revoked if payment of the invoice is not made by the timescale stated on the invoice;
(c) Reproduction rights (if and when granted) are strictly limited to the use and period of time specified on v1images Aviation Media’s invoice. An agreement must be reached with v1images Aviation Media before the pictures are used for a different purpose or after the licence to use has expired;
(d) Reproduction rights are not issued exclusively to the Client except when specified on the invoice;
(e) Reproduction rights granted are personal to the Client and may not be assigned, nor may any picture submitted to the Client be loaned or transferred to third parties save for the purpose of the exercise by the Client of such reproduction rights;
(f) Any reproduction rights granted are by way of licence and no partial or other assignment of copyright shall be implied;
(g) v1images Aviation Media reserves the right to refuse to supply or grant a reproduction licence to a third party when requested to do so by the Client;
(h) In the case of printed publications, three copies of the relevant pages containing any picture supplied are to be furnished to v1images Aviation Media free of charge within two weeks. In other media, evidence of use must be made available if requested;
(i) On the Client’s death or bankruptcy or (if the Client is a company) in the event of a Resolution, Petition or Order for winding up being made against it, or if a Receiver is appointed, v1images Aviation Media may at any time thereafter inspect any records, accounts and books relating to the reproduction of its pictures to ensure that the pictures are being used only in accordance with the reproduction rights granted to the Client.

5. Definitions of Reproduction Rights:

The following terms are used when describing the reproduction rights granted by v1images Aviation Media and the Photographer to the Client:

(a) Internal Use only: The right to use the pictures only within a company for non-commercial purposes; publication in a free in-house magazine not normally available to the public; exhibition within the Client’s premises; editorial use in the Client’s intranet site;
(b) PR and Press distribution: The right to use the pictures as described in 4(a); plus a licence for third parties to reproduce such pictures in print or electronic media in an editorial context where no fee has been paid to guarantee publication;
(c) Specified Use Only: The right to use the pictures once only for the purpose as described on the invoice;
(d) Editorial: One reproduction only of pictures supplied within one print edition of the specified title in an editorial context only.
